Northcentral University Application Deadlines & Admission Dates 2026
Northcentral University follows a Rolling Admissions policy, meaning applications are reviewed as they arrive and there is no single fixed deadline.
Key Admission Dates
Northcentral University reviews applications continuously throughout the year. Seats and scholarships are awarded on a first-come, first-served basis, so applying early gives you a significant advantage for both admission and financial aid.

Is a Northcentral University Degree Worth It?
Whether Northcentral University is worth it depends less on its reputation and more on your program choice, financial aid package, and career goals — here's the data to weigh it against.
The average household income among admitted students is $63,200, with a graduate unemployment rate of 2.9%.
25.5% of students receive a Pell Grant and 31.1% take federal loans at Northcentral University — file your FAFSA early and list Northcentral University as a choice to be considered for both.
How much does a Northcentral University Graduate earn?
Median earnings 10 years after enrollment (roughly 4–6 years post-graduation) are $48,414 — about 19% above the U.S. median graduate income.
